Universal service

Глоссарий по экологии и "зеленой" энергетике
  1. Energy service sufficient for basic needs (an evolving bundle of basic services) available to and affordable by virtually all members of the population.

  2. A policy of making a product accessible to all citizens at affordable prices. this policy might use targeted subsidies to achieve the stated objective.


Универсальная услуга, русский
    Политика производства доступного для всех граждан продукта по доступным ценам. такая политика может использовать целевые субсидии для достижения поставленной цели.

Service advertising protocol, английский
    A netware protocol used to identify the services and addresses of servers attached to the network. when a server starts, it uses the protocol to advertise its service. when the same server goes offline, it uses the protocol to announce that it is no longer available.
